In order to further facilitate the filing of declarations even after the office hours, the Pr. CCs.I.T are instructed to ensure that the counters for receiving the declarations under I.D.S., 2016 remain open till 8.00 P.M. on 28th and 29th September, 2016 in all jurisdictions.
Concern was raised by field authorities that there can be few cases where the assessees may not have PAN but would like to file declaration under the Scheme towards the date of closure of the Scheme. In such cases, the assessee may not get PAN by the date of closure of the Scheme i.e. 30.09.2016
In order to facilitate the declarants who would like to file the declaration in paper form, the CBDT has issued instructions to all Principal Chief Commissioners of Income Tax across India to ensure that arrangements are made for receiving such declarations till midnight of 30-09-2016.
Instances have been brought to the notice of the Board that some taxpayers are of the view that if a capital asset acquired out of undisclosed income is sold before 01.06.2016 and the sale proceeds so received are held in cash, then the amount of undisclosed income required to be declared under the Scheme shall be the amount of undisclosed income invested

Principal Commissioners or Commissioners are advised to take a lenient view on receipt of a valid application under section 273A of the Act in respect of an issue for the said assessment year which is identical to the issue on which a valid declaration has been made under the Income Deceleration Scheme 2016 for other assessment year(s) subject to payment of the entire amount payable under the Scheme.

As regards, concerns regarding confidentiality of the information filed under the The Income Declaration Scheme, 201, it is reiterated that information contained in a valid declaration is confidential and shall not be shared.
The CBDT has so far refrained from issuing any statement regarding number of declarations received, amounts declared or taxes paid under the Scheme in order to ensure complete confidentiality. The confidential handling of declarations made under the Scheme is of utmost importance to the Income Tax Department and the CBDT is aware of its responsibility towards fulfilling this crucial role.
In order to facilitate filing of declarations under Income Declaration Scheme 2016 even after office hours, Pr.CCs.I.T. are instructed to ensure that counters for receiving declarations under I.D.S., 2016 remain open till midnight of 30th September, 2016 in all jurisdictions.
